个人介绍
技术能力清单:Java、Jni、Ndk、OpenNI、OpenGL、javascript、ES6、html、css、Scss、vue2/3、WebGL、glsl、git、three.js、tween.js、cesium.js、babylon.js、bash
工作经历
2019-08-19 -2023-05-03亚信科技高级前端工程师
1. 负责公司三维产品的研发工作,包括产品技术选型、开发架构等。 2. 负责公司三维项目的需求对接、功能开发、项目交付工作。 3. 负责三维研发团队的日常技术分享与学习。 4. 负责三维产品的 SDK 开发工作。 5. 负责日常的团队管理工作。 6. 负责公司层面的3D项目对接与管理工作。
2016-04-01 -2019-08-16湖南拓视觉信息技术有限公司高级前端工程师
1. 开发公司前端三维数据的展示,交互,动画。( 基于 three.js 和 tween.js ) 2. 完成三维模块的业务集成。( 比如看房业务,消防业务,展厅业务 ) 3. 三维展示功能的 sdk 开发。( 基于 vue,vuex。使用 class 分模块 ) 4. 三维模块的性能优化。( lod 加载,多线程,离屏渲染 ) 5. 开发基于 Android 系统的体感应用。 6. 小组成员的管理。
教育经历
2010-09-01 - 2014-06-30衡阳师范学院计算机科学与技术本科
技能
1. 分析客户需求完成技术选型。(cesium.js + heatmap.js) 2. 完成地面与建筑的热力效果渲染。 3. 对接经纬度数据,根据真实数据完成热力贴图更新。 4. 实现建筑物模型的点击拾取。 5. 实现视角的可视化控制与动画效果。 6. 优化视觉效果,增加抗锯齿能力。 7. 实现观察区域切换功能。
1. 项目技术选型与框架搭建。 2. 三维数据的加载和渲染。 3. 三维动画效果(视角环绕动画、视角缓动动画)。 4. 用户交互效果(视角的平移、旋转、缩放),鼠标的点击与悬停效果。 5. 后处理视觉特效,比如辉光、抗锯齿。 6. 状态模拟,比如会议室状态模拟、监控视角模拟、水电管线模拟、车位状态模拟、光照模拟等。